Butchers Arms Pub in Bassetlaw
Where is Butchers Arms Pub?
🏠 2 Gildingwells Rd, Woodsetts, Worksop S81 8QA
"The Butchers Arms is a great British pub in the heart of the Woodsetts community. We have something for everyone, The Butchers Arms is a great pub with stylish and comfortable surroundings to catch up with friends over a drink or take in the big match atmosphere of watching live sports. We have free Wi-Fi and host regular entertainment so there’s plenty of occasions to come down and enjoy your great local pub. You can grab a bite to eat from our menu which has all the pub favourites from curry’s to fish and chips, or build your own burger!"
